Roman Silver Ring with Clasped Hands

2ND-4TH CENTURY A.D. OR LATER

1 in. (11.54 grams, 26.32 mm overall, 21.36 mm internal diameter (approximate size British T 1/2, USA 9 3/4, Europe 21.89, Japan 21)).

Plano-convex hoop and disc bezel with raised rim, wreath and mani-in-fede motif. [No Reserve]

Provenance

UK private collection before 2000.
Acquired on the UK art market.
Private collection, London, UK.
